I am trying to get the Providence Journal at www.projo.com but am not getting any articles. Any advice would be greatly appreciated. Here is my Recipe:
import re from calibre.web.feeds.news import BasicNewsRecipe class ProvidenceJournal(BasicNewsRecipe): title = 'Providence Journal' description = 'RI news' __author__ = 'Kovid Goyal and Sujata Raman' use_embedded_content = False max_articles_per_feed = 20 language = 'en' remove_javascript = True no_stylesheets = True extra_css = ''' #articleCopyright { font-family:Arial,helvetica,sans-serif ; font-weight:bold ; font-size:x-small ;} p { font-family:"Times New Roman",times,serif ; font-weight:normal ; font-size:small ;} body{font-family:arial,helvetica,sans-serif} ''' feeds = [ ('Today\'s Highlights', 'http://www.projo.com/newskiosk/rss/projolocalnews.xml'), ('Politics', 'http://politicsblog.projo.com/index.xml'), ('7 to 7: Rhode Island\'s breaking news blog', 'http://newsblog.projo.com/index.xml'), ('Music', 'http://www.projo.com/newskiosk/rss/projomusic.xml') ] remove_tags = [{'id':['pfmnav', 'ArticleCommentsWrapper']}] def get_article_url(self, article): return article.get('guid', article.get('link', None)) def print_version(self, url): return url.rpartition('.')[0] + '_pf.html' def postprocess_html(self, soup, first): for div in soup.findAll(name='div', style=re.compile('margin')): div['style'] = '' return soup |
